Hendricks opens 4th Ga. Thomasville store
By Furniture Today Staff -- Furniture Today, January 30, 2005
Kennesaw, Ga. — Top 100 company Hendricks Furniture Group, based in North Carolina, has opened a Thomasville store here, its fourth in Georgia.
Hendricks operates 12 Thomasville stores in Georgia, North Carolina and Florida, including the new prototype store in Jamestown, N.C., which opened during the High Point market in October.
The Kennesaw store is one of the first in the network to incorporate the prototype's new signage program.
The 13,000-square-foot Kennesaw store offers all of Thomasville's major collections, including new collections Beekman Place and Irving Park, and the popular Bogart and Hemingway collections. Todd Trail is store manager.
Owner Larry Hendricks said, "The Thomasville brand is already pretty well known in Kennesaw, due to the success of our stores in Atlanta, Alpharetta and the Mall of Georgia."
Thomasville is a subsidiary of Furniture Brands International.
